Mintbread wrote:I have seen a couple of threads lately containing motorcycle accident videos and I have not watched one.

Why would motorcyclists want to watch other riders crashing in the worst possible ways?
I don't think threads like this are started for sadistic reasons, but certainly for other riders to learn from the mistakes, or misfortunes of the fellow riders on video. As an example

Biker Gets Hit 2 - Maybe he was going too fast, but it didn't seem to me as if the car was rushing across the intersection....it appears the car didn't see the motorcyclist. Lesson learned - Even when you're in plain view assume they dont see you.

Biker Gets Slammed - Not sure why this rider was using a cross walk and riding his bike in the pedestrian area, but he clearly has right of way. Lesson learned - don't go until you know the oncoming traffic is stopping.

Biker gets owned by a car - The originator of this video put the description as 'Finally a biker gets it.. I'm sick of them swirving in front of my car ' Lesson learned - There are some complete idiots out there with no thought to the consideration or safety of others, and I'm not even talking about the video here!

Biker Collision - Lesson learned - Bikers can be idiots too...

Just because you don't watch them doen't mean they don't or might not happen.
